Malcolm Lincoln & Manpower 4 to Oslo for Estonia

12 March 2010 at 23:49 CET

The decision to move the show to the Nokia Concert Hall in Tallinn, and opening it up for a general public audience proved a big success as the arena was completely sold out. Last years Estonian representatives Urban Symphony opened the show. The crowd enthusiastically supported all of the acts. The ten participating songs were as follows in order of performance :-

  •  3 Pead - Poolel Teel
  •  Marten Kuningas & Mahavok - Oota Mind Veel
  •  Mimicry - New
  •  Tiiu Kiik - The One And Only Love
  •  Violina feat Rolf Junior - Maagiline PĂ€ev
  •  Disco 4000 - Ei Usu
  •  Iiris Vesik - Astronaut
  •  Lenna Kuurmaa - Rapunzel
  •  Groundhog Day - Teiste Seest KĂ”igile
  •  Malcolm Lincoln & Manpower 4 - Siren 

After the performances, and while all of the votes were being cast, an interval act followed where there were performances from hard rock band Metsatöll.

As with many countries this year, Estonia opted for a split voting decision to decide their entry. A number of professional juries and the televoting public shared a 50/50 vote weighting. The televoting audience This combined voting resulted in the top two acts moving forward to a sing off superfinal.These were Lenna Kuurmaa and Malcolm Lincoln & Manpower 4.

The superfinal result was decided by televoting only. Malcolm Lincoln and Manpower 4 won the public vote and therefore the ticket to Oslo.

Estonia finished 6th last year with Urban Symphony's RĂ€ndajad in the Final of Europe's favourite TV-show. It was the first time that the small Baltic nation qualified since the introduction of the Semi-Finals system in 2004.

Estonia will participate in the first part of the First Semi Final of Europe's Favourite TV Show on Tuesday 25th May in Oslo.
